Quotes and love

I'm still thinking a lot about love and how it's the greatest force in the universe.  And how I miss it in its physical presence...  I ran across these quotes and thought I'd share them with you.  They make me a little melancholy and sad, but mostly they make me smile as I remember sweet memories of Austin and I and how lucky I am to have known such  beautiful, tender, passionate and fierce love in my life.   If I never know another love, this love that we shared will be enough.   I hope these quotes bring some sweet memories to mind for you too....


 

“I don't pretend to know what love is for everyone, but I can tell you what it is for me.  Love is knowing all about someone, and still wanting to be with them more than any other person.  Love is trusting them enough to tell them everything about yourself, including the things you might be ashamed of.  Love is feeling comfortable and safe with someone, but still getting weak knees when they walk into a room

 and smile at you

-- Author Unknown





“For it was not into my ear you whispered, but into my heart. It was not my lips you kissed, but my soul.”

-- Judy Garland


If you count all the stars in the sky, all the grains of sand in the oceans, all the roses in the world and all the smiles that have ever been, then you will have a sample of how much I love you.
-- Author Unknown






I miss you when something really good happens, because you're the one I want to share it with. I miss you when something is troubling me, because you're the one who understands me so well. I miss you when I laugh and cry, because I know that you are the one that makes my laughter grow, and my tears disappear. I miss you all the time, but I miss you the most when I lay awake at night, and think of all the wonderful times that we spent with each other for those were some of the best and most memorable times of my life.

-- Author Unknown
